Halloween came and went in downtown Elizabethton on Monday as local merchants filled the buckets of hundreds of dressed up creatures from princesses to blood-sucking vampires in the annual trick-or-treating held on the sidewalks in downtown.
The event started at 3 p.m. and was supposed to end at 4:30 p.m. but the lines still stretched to almost J’s Corner for much of the event as merchants handed out goodies until the last piece of candy cleared their buckets.
There were tons of smiles on the faces of the children who had come out to thankfully receive the sweets that were dropped in each bucket as the chain of trick-or-treaters started at one end of the downtown and proceeded to the end before circling back up and around to the other side.
Kids were not the only ones who took advantage of the day set aside to dress up as many adults — parents and grandparents — also came dressed to walk along with their children.
A great time was had by one and all as the merchants once again provided a memorable time for those who didn’t let a few clouds stop them from having a great day of Halloween trick-or-treating.
